public abstract class ThresholdingOutputStream
extends java.io.OutputStream
This class overrides all OutputStream methods. However, these
overrides ultimately call the corresponding methods in the underlying output
stream implementation.
NOTE: This implementation may trigger the event before the threshold is actually reached, since it triggers when a pending write operation would cause the threshold to be exceeded.
